为什么写这个?

写这个库是为了在使用HttpURLConnection来发送HTTP请求的时候更加方便快捷

Apache HttpComponents这样的组件也是非常好用的,但是有些时候为了更加简单,或者可能因为你部署的环境的问题(比如Android),你只想使用例如HttpURLConnection一些过时但是又好用的库。

这个库寻找一种更加方便和一种更加通用的模式来模拟HTTP请求,并支持多种特性的请求,例如多个请求的任务.

示例

执行一个GET请求并返回响应的状态信息

int response = HttpRequest.get("http:https://google.com").code();

执行一个GET请求并返回响应的body信息

String response = HttpRequest.get("http:https://google.com").body();
System.out.println("Response was: " + response);

标准打印一个GET请求的响应数据

HttpRequest.get("http:https://google.com").receive(System.out);

添加请求参数

HttpRequest request = HttpRequest.get("http:https://google.com", true, 'q', "baseball gloves", "size", 100);
System.out.println(request.toString()); // GET http:https://google.com?q=baseball%20gloves&size=100

使用数组作为请求参数

int[] ids = new int[] { 22, 23 };
HttpRequest request = HttpRequest.get("http:https://google.com", true, "id", ids);
System.out.println(request.toString()); // GET http:https://google.com?id[]=22&id[]=23

和请求/响应的请求头一起使用

String contentType = HttpRequest.get("http:https://google.com")
                                .accept("application/json") //Sets request header
                                .contentType(); //Gets response header
System.out.println("Response content type was " + contentType);

执行一个带数据的POST请求并返回响应的状态

int response = HttpRequest.post("http:https://google.com").send("name=kevin").code();

使用最基本的认证请求

int response = HttpRequest.get("http:https://google.com").basic("username", "p4ssw0rd").code();

执行有文件的请求

HttpRequest request = HttpRequest.post("http:https://google.com");
request.part("status[body]", "Making a multipart request");
request.part("status[image]", new File("/home/kevin/Pictures/ide.png"));
if (request.ok())
  System.out.println("Status was updated");

执行一个具有表单数据的POST请求

Map<String, String> data = new HashMap<String, String>();
data.put("user", "A User");
data.put("state", "CA");
if (HttpRequest.post("http:https://google.com").form(data).created())
  System.out.println("User was created");

把响应的body信息存放在文件中

File output = new File("/output/request.out");
HttpRequest.get("http:https://google.com").receive(output);

POST请求包含文件

File input = new File("/input/data.txt");
int response = HttpRequest.post("http:https://google.com").send(input).code();

POST请求字符串二进制文件

String base64 = base64(t[i].getAbsolutePath());
String body = HttpRequest.post(url)
	.part("base64Strs", new ByteArrayInputStream(base64.getBytes())).body();

使用实体标签进行缓存

File latest = new File("/data/cache.json");
HttpRequest request = HttpRequest.get("http:https://google.com");
//Copy response to file
request.receive(latest);
//Store eTag of response
String eTag = request.eTag();
//Later on check if changes exist
boolean unchanged = HttpRequest.get("http:https://google.com")
                               .ifNoneMatch(eTag)
                               .notModified();

使用gzip压缩方式

HttpRequest request = HttpRequest.get("http:https://google.com");
//Tell server to gzip response and automatically uncompress
request.acceptGzipEncoding().uncompress(true);
String uncompressed = request.body();
System.out.println("Uncompressed response is: " + uncompressed);

当使用HTTPS协议是忽略安全

HttpRequest request = HttpRequest.get("https://google.com");
//Accept all certificates
request.trustAllCerts();
//Accept all hostnames
request.trustAllHosts();

配置一个HTTP请求代理

HttpRequest request = HttpRequest.get("https://google.com");
//Configure proxy
request.useProxy("localhost", 8080);
//Optional proxy basic authentication
request.proxyBasic("username", "p4ssw0rd");

重定向

int code = HttpRequest.get("http:https://google.com").followRedirects(true).code();

自定义连接工场

查看 OkHttp来使用该库? 查看 here.

HttpRequest.setConnectionFactory(new ConnectionFactory() {

  public HttpURLConnection create(URL url) throws IOException {
    if (!"https".equals(url.getProtocol()))
      throw new IOException("Only secure requests are allowed");
    return (HttpURLConnection) url.openConnection();
  }

  public HttpURLConnection create(URL url, Proxy proxy) throws IOException {
    if (!"https".equals(url.getProtocol()))
      throw new IOException("Only secure requests are allowed");
    return (HttpURLConnection) url.openConnection(proxy);
  }
});
